
无论是金融、医疗、教育还是电子商务等领域,数据的安全性和可靠性都是企业持续运营和发展的基石
然而,数据面临着来自内部和外部的多种威胁,如硬件故障、人为错误、恶意攻击等,这些都可能导致数据丢失或损坏
因此,建立高效可靠的数据库自动备份系统,对于保护企业数据安全、降低数据丢失风险具有重要意义
本文将深入探讨如何打造一套高效的“My数据库自动备份”系统,以确保您的数据安全无忧
一、数据库备份的重要性 数据库备份是指将数据库中的数据复制到另一个存储介质(如硬盘、磁带、光盘或云存储)的过程,以便在原始数据损坏或丢失时能够恢复
数据库备份的重要性体现在以下几个方面: 1.数据恢复:在数据丢失或损坏的情况下,备份是恢复数据的唯一手段
通过备份,可以迅速将数据库恢复到某个特定的时间点,从而最大限度地减少数据丢失
2.灾难恢复:自然灾害、硬件故障、恶意攻击等可能导致数据库无法访问
此时,备份是恢复数据库正常运行的关键
3.合规性:许多行业和法规要求企业保留特定时间段内的数据
通过定期备份,可以确保企业满足这些合规要求
4.测试和开发:备份数据还可以用于测试和开发环境,以模拟生产环境中的数据场景,降低对生产环境的影响
二、My数据库自动备份系统的设计原则 在设计“My数据库自动备份”系统时,应遵循以下原则以确保其高效性和可靠性: 1.自动化:自动备份可以确保数据在不被人为干扰的情况下定期备份
通过设置定时任务或利用数据库管理系统的内置功能,可以实现备份的自动化
2.完整性:备份数据必须完整,包括数据库中的所有表、视图、索引、存储过程等对象
同时,还要确保备份数据的一致性,避免在备份过程中出现数据不一致的情况
3.安全性:备份数据应存储在安全的位置,防止未经授权的访问和篡改
可以通过加密、访问控制等手段提高备份数据的安全性
4.可恢复性:备份数据应易于恢复
在需要恢复数据时,应能够快速定位到备份文件并成功恢复数据库
5.可扩展性:随着数据库的增长,备份系统应能够支持更大的数据量和更复杂的备份需求
通过采用分布式存储、并行备份等技术手段,可以提高备份系统的可扩展性
三、My数据库自动备份系统的实现步骤 1. 选择备份工具 根据数据库的类型和规模,选择合适的备份工具
对于MySQL数据库,可以使用mysqldump、MySQL Enterprise Backup等工具进行备份
这些工具具有易用性、高效性和可靠性等优点,能够满足大多数企业的备份需求
2. 配置备份策略 制定详细的备份策略,包括备份时间、备份频率、备份类型(全量备份、增量备份、差异备份)等
根据企业的实际需求,可以设置每天、每周或每月的备份计划,并确保备份在业务低峰期进行以减少对业务的影响
3. 设置自动备份任务 利用操作系统的任务计划程序(如Windows的Task Scheduler、Linux的cron等)或数据库管理系统的内置功能(如MySQL的Event Scheduler),设置自动备份任务
这些任务将按照预定的时间和策略执行备份操作,并将备份文件存储在指定的位置
4. 验证备份数据 定期验证备份数据的完整性和可恢复性
通过恢复测试,可以确保备份数据在需要时能够成功恢复数据库
同时,还可以检查备份过程中是否存在潜在的问题,并及时进行调整和优化
5. 监控和管理备份系统 建立备份系统的监控和管理机制,实时跟踪备份任务的执行情况和备份数据的存储状态
通过日志记录、报警通知等手段,可以及时发现和处理备份过程中的异常情况,确保备份系统的稳定运行
四、My数据库自动备份系统的优化策略 为了进一步提高“My数据库自动备份”系统的效率和可靠性,可以采取以下优化策略: 1.压缩和加密备份数据:通过压缩备份数据,可以减少存储空间的占用和备份时间的消耗
同时,对备份数据进行加密可以确保数据的安全性,防止未经授权的访问和篡改
2.分布式存储:将备份数据存储在多个物理位置,可以提高数据的可用性和容错性
在单个存储节点出现故障时,可以从其他节点恢复数据,确保业务的连续性
3.并行备份:对于大型数据库,可以采用并行备份技术,同时备份多个表或分区,以缩短备份时间
通过合理分配资源,可以确保备份任务在合理的时间内完成
4.增量和差异备份:与全量备份相比,增量备份和差异备份只备份自上次备份以来发生变化的数据,可以大大减少备份数据的量和备份时间
同时,在恢复数据时,也可以根据需要选择恢复全量备份和相应的增量或差异备份,提高恢复效率
5.定期审计和清理:定期对备份数据进行审计和清理,删除过期的、无用的备份文件,释放存储空间
同时,还可以检查备份数据的完整性和一致性,确保备份数据的可靠性
五、结论 “My数据库自动备份”系统是企业数据安全的重要保障
通过选择合适的备份工具、制定详细的备份策略、设置自动备份任务、验证备份数据以及监控和管理备份系统,可以确保数据库数据的安全性和可靠性
同时,通过采用压缩和加密、分布式存储、并行备份、增量和差异备份以及定期审计和清理等优化策略,可以进一步提高备份系统的效率和可靠性
在未来的发展中,随着技术的不断进步和数据规模的持续增长,“My数据库自动备份”系统将继续发挥重要作用,为企业的数据安全保驾护航
全面指南:如何进行服务器热备份,确保数据安全无忧
打造高效my数据库自动备份方案
SQL数据库备份:扩展名操作指南
Dell服务器备份高效恢复指南
SQL2008数据库双备份操作指南
轻松学会:企业微信通讯录备份技巧
2000SQL数据库:自动化备份全攻略
全面指南:如何进行服务器热备份,确保数据安全无忧
SQL数据库备份:扩展名操作指南
Dell服务器备份高效恢复指南
SQL2008数据库双备份操作指南
2000SQL数据库:自动化备份全攻略
打造安全防线:如何高效利用服务器做备份盘策略
SQL数据库备份与收缩技巧详解
Oracle数据库用户备份全攻略
苹果设备备份软件数据库全攻略
戴尔服务器:硬盘双备份,数据更安心
U8帐套备份:数据库解压操作指南
数据库备份恢复实操指南